Abstract

The radiative lifetime measurements by the time-resolved laser-induced fluorescence technique are reported for 24 levels of Co i with the energy range of 283 45.86–55 922.3 cm−1, amongst which the lifetimes of 20 levels are reported for the first time. The branching fraction measurements by the emission spectrum of a hollow cathode lamp were performed for 11 levels of them together with other two levels reported in the literature, and branching fractions of 39 transitions were obtained. By combining them with lifetime values, the transition probabilities and absolute oscillator strengths of these lines were determined.
